It was narrated that An Numan bin Bashir said: “The sun eclipsed during the time of the Messenger of Allah صلی اللہ علیہ وآلہ وسلم and he rushed out dragging his cloak until he came to the Masjid. He continued leading us in prayer until the eclipse ended. When it ended he said: ‘People claim that the eclipse of the sun and the moon only happens when a great man dies, but that is not so. Eclipses of the sun and the moon do not happen for the death or birth of anyone, but they are signs from Allah, the Mighty and Sublime. When Allah, the Mighty and Sublime, manifests Himself to anything of His creation, it humbles itself before Him, so if you see that then pray like the last obligatory prayer you did before that.” (Da’if)
